#6f2914 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6f2914 is composed of 43.5% red, 16.1% green and 7.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 63.1% magenta, 82% yellow and 56.5% black. It has a hue angle of 13.8 degrees, a saturation of 69.5% and a lightness of 25.7%. #6f2914 color hex could be obtained by blending #de5228 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663300.

#6f2914 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6f2914 has RGB values of R:111, G:41, B:20 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.63, Y:0.82, K:0.56. Its decimal value is 7285012.
